Abstract
The utility model discloses a film stick pressing machine which comprises a workbench. Two sides of the workbench are provided with a group of supporting shaft bases. A rotary roller is arranged between the supporting shaft bases through a rotary shaft. One end of the rotary shaft is connected with a gear motor. A connecting rod is arranged above the rotary roller. Two ends of the connecting rod are connected with the supporting shaft bases and movably connected with two ends of the rotary shaft. One end side of the connecting rod is further connected with a rotary pulling rod. The film stick pressing machine can press a film stick base piece tightly, removes air bubbles in the film stick, and improves quality of film stick finished products.

Background technology
Pad pasting had both played effect attractive in appearance to electronic product, had also played the effect of protecting and prevent static simultaneously.Different according to the electronic product kind, various film pastes and also is not quite similar.
Paste processing factory for middle-size and small-size film, when the film of producing small-sized electronic product pasted, the film subsides substrate that normally will provide size was placed on and carries out punching press in the diel, pastes shape thereby obtain needed film.
Under production scale was not very big situation, film pasted substrate and all by operating personnel are manual pad pasting and egative film is fitted usually, and the film of manual assembly pastes substrate and tends to exist a large amount of bubbles, and it is not tight to fit, thereby can influence the quality of film subsides.

The specific embodiment
Below in conjunction with the accompanying drawing among the utility model embodiment, the technical scheme among the utility model embodiment is clearly and completely described.
The utility model provides a kind of film pressing to close machine, film is pasted substrate once press close to pressing, discharges the bubble in it, thereby guarantees the quality that film pastes.
Referring to structural representation shown in Figure 1, film pressing disclosed in the utility model is closed machine and is comprised workbench 11, workbench 11 both sides are provided with one group and support axle bed 12, support between the axle bed 12 and be connected with a rotating shaft 13, rotating shaft 13 is rotated by the drive of the reducing motor 14 of its distolateral connection, be arranged with live-rollers 15 on the rotating shaft 13, can rotate synchronously in company with rotating shaft 13.The top of live-rollers 15 is provided with a connecting rod 16, the two ends of connecting rod 16 also are connected with support axle bed 12, simultaneously, its two ends also flexibly connect with the two ends of rotating shaft 13 respectively, the one distolateral rotating rod 17 that is provided with of connecting rod 16, during with rotating rod 17 pulling downwards, connecting rod 16 is upwards mentioned, and on the while driven rotary is axial, makes live-rollers 15 break away from workbench 11, when rotating rod 17 is upwards spurred, connecting rod 16 falls, and driven rotary axially down, makes live-rollers 15 be adjacent to workbench 11 simultaneously, start reducing motor simultaneously and start working, the entry into service of power driven rotary axle is provided.Operating personnel paste film substrate at an end of workbench and are placed on below the live-rollers 15, live-rollers 15 is in the process of running, by the frictional force of rotating film is pasted substrate and be transported to the other end from an end of workbench 11, when carrying film being pasted substrate compresses, get rid of bubble, it is more tight to make it to fit, thereby has improved the quality that film pastes.
